Job Summary

Assists Utilities Mechanic in performing preventive and corrective maintenance on all equipment and systems in water stations. Position reports to the Head Operator.

Essential Functions

  • Assists in troubleshooting and performing preventive and corrective maintenance on all equipment in water systems
  • Assists in disassembling, rebuilding, and reassembling motors, valves, pumps, gearboxes, etc. to rehabilitate equipment
  • Check out and evaluate operation of equipment after rebuild is complete
  • Assists in performing minor electrical work in conjunction with mechanical repairs (e.g., connects/disconnects wires, investigates/corrects minor pump control problems)
  • Responds to emergency and customer complaint calls
  • Requests the purchase of parts, equipment, and services needed to perform repairs
  • Documents all preventive and corrective work performed
  • Performs minor welding and cutting work to complete repairs and fabricate parts for bracing/repairs
  • Performs station checks as needed
  • Collections and analyzes water samples as needed
